1993 Toyota Coaster

1993 Toyota Coaster in 妙手仁心 (Healing Hands), TV Series, 1998 IMDB Ep. 11

Class: Bus, Single-deck — Model origin: JP

1993 Toyota Coaster

[*] Background vehicle 

Comments about this vehicle

No comments yet

Add a comment

You must login to post comments...

Advertising